Understanding the Significance of Fortresses in Cultural Heritage

Ancient fortresses, ranging from medieval castles to classical city walls, are more than stone and mortar; they are symbols of power, resilience, and cultural identity. According to recent studies by the International Council on Monuments and Sites (ICOMOS), over 60% of UNESCO World Heritage sites include significant fortress components, underscoring their global importance. Preserving these sites is essential for educational, tourism, and national pride purposes.

Emerging Technologies in Fortress Preservation

Technological innovation has revolutionized conservation strategies. High-resolution 3D laser scanning, photogrammetry, and drone surveys allow detailed mapping of structures with minimal invasion. For example, the reconstruction of the Tower of London’s fortress walls utilized these methods to identify historical fabric and plan targeted interventions.

Additionally, advancements in materials science now enable conservationists to develop bespoke, historically accurate restoration compounds that enhance durability while respecting original aesthetics.

Industry Challenges and the Future of Fortress Conservation

Despite technological progress, challenges remain. Climate change accelerates deterioration, and urban development pressures threaten site integrity. There is a pressing need for policies that integrate conservation with sustainable urban planning. Furthermore, increasing public engagement through digital virtual tours and augmented reality experiences can foster broader appreciation and stewardship of heritage sites.

Investment in specialized training for conservators and the adoption of interdisciplinary approaches—combining archaeology, engineering, and digital technology—are essential to meet these challenges successfully.

Comparison of Preservation Techniques
Method Application Advantages Limitations
Traditional Stabilization Use of lime mortar, stone patching Historically authentic, proven durability Labor-intensive, limited adaptability to modern needs
Digital Reconstruction 3D modeling, VR experiences Enhanced visualization, educational outreach Costly, requires technical expertise
Modern Materials Composite resins, advanced sealants High durability, minimal aesthetic impact Potential environmental concerns, cost
